  • Tour state parks via library slide show

    The Friends of Spotswood Library will host a N.J. State Parks slide show April 21 at 1:30 p.m. at the library, 548 Main St. Author and photographer Kevin Woyce will narrate the illustrated tour of some of our state’s most beautiful scenery. For more information, call 732-251-1515.

  • Restaurant fundraiser to benefit cat rescue

    Uno Chicago Grill, 61 Route 1, Metuchen, will host a fundraiser to benefit Whiskers Rescue on April 20-22. Uno Chicago Grill will donate 15 percent of sales when customers present a certificate to the server. If sales eventually exceed $1,000, the restaurant will increase the donation to 20 percent.
